On Monday Assemblyman Tom Ammiano introduced a bill that would legalize marijuana. The purpose of legalization would be no other than taxation. With the state still being pushed towards the deficit cliff, any new source of funds seems like a good one.

Marijuana is reported to be California's cash crop raking in over $10 billion a year. That puts it above all other crops raised in the state. So of course the politicians see a new revenue stream and their eyes light up.

President Barack Obama sure wishes everyone paid their taxes. Mainly because three of his picks for some high ranking positions have been held up in confirmation hearings because they failed to pay taxes.

First it started off with Treasury Secretary Tim Geinther. It was found that he some how did not pay about $35,000 in taxes. Reports said some of this was because he tried to do his own returns some years. Oops! Bet he won't try that again. Luckily he was able to pay the back taxes and the politicians in Congress decided to look the other way eventually confirming Geinther.

Second came former Senator Tom Daschle. Now this guy forgot to pay about $140,000 in taxes that were overlooked because of a "complex tax code." The taxes were traced back to a driver he used and did not pay taxes on. So because of Daschle's mistakes, it cost him the position of secretary of health and human services. The man who was supposed to save and revamp the health care industry pulled out of his bid on Tuesday. President Obama came out and said he made the mistake and would take responsibility.

And finally, we have Nancy Killefer who was to take the role of White House performance officer, whatever that is. Well this little lady forgot to pay employment taxes for her household help. The actual amount was not disclosed but it was bad enough that Killefer withdrew her bid.

So the moral of the story is if you want to hold a high ranking position in government one day, you might want to pay your taxes. It could come back to haunt you.

 Lately Governor Schwarzenegger has been barking up the budget tree so people have started to take it seriously. So yesterday, after a summer of budget woes and a few special sessions there was a plan.

 

Democrats in Sacramento devised a plan to raise $9.3 billion dollars through new taxes in the form of fees. This would cut the current $18 billion deficit in half. By calling the taxes fees the Democrats were able to pass to measures without the 2/3rd majority vote needed for the budget and any new taxes.

 

Yesterday, the bill arrived at Governor Schwarzenegger desk and he vetoed it. The LA Times said Schwarzenegger "complained the plan did not go as far as he wanted to stimulate the economy."[LA TIMES ARTICLE] So the Governor has sent the only idea he's seen in a long time back to the drawing board.
